The Development of Hardstyle: From Its Below Ground Origins to Global Supremacy

Hardstyle, a subgenre of electronic dancing music (EDM), is recognized for its heavy bass, busy rhythms, and effective kicks. What started as a particular niche genre in the below ground dancing scene of the Netherlands has turned into an international phenomenon, fascinating target markets with its intense power and blissful tunes. Hardstyle has a dedicated and enthusiastic following, with fans welcoming the style's one-of-a-kind mix of compelling beats and enjoyable, ariose breaks.

This post checks out the advancement of hardstyle, from its early starts in the 1990s to its contemporary condition as one of the most popular subgenres in the EDM world. We'll dive into the elements that specify hardstyle, its surge in worldwide popularity, key events that have actually championed the genre, and its impact on the more comprehensive electronic songs landscape.

The Early Days of Hardstyle: A Below Ground Activity
Hardstyle originated in the late 1990s and very early 2000s, progressing out of the Dutch hardcore techno scene, with strong impacts from other busy electronic categories like gabber and tough trance. At the time, the Dutch go crazy scene was flourishing, and the audios of fast, hostile techno were becoming a lot more popular in below ground clubs and celebrations. Musicians and DJs in the Netherlands started try out mixing the pounding basslines and kicks of hardcore with even more melodic and structured aspects from various other genres.

The result was a noise that was hefty yet rhythmic, aggressive yet available. Early hardstyle tracks usually included a driving bassline, high-pitched synth tunes, and pitched kicks, developing a sound that was both raw and euphoric. The energy of the music was ideal for rave atmospheres, and hardstyle rapidly obtained an online reputation for its capacity to maintain groups dancing for hours.

Among the very first significant hardstyle tracks was "Pulsation" by Dutch manufacturer Dana, launched in 2000. Dana is commonly thought about one of the pioneers of the genre, and her songs assisted lay the structure for the advancement of hardstyle. Together with other very early hardstyle DJs like The Prophet, Luna, and Zany, Dana played an essential function fit the category's early sound and bringing it to a broader audience.

Hardstyle was not immediately welcomed by mainstream EDM fans, yet it discovered a home in underground goes crazy and smaller sized festivals. The style's early years were specified by a close-knit area of DJs, manufacturers, and fans that were passionate regarding the high-energy, hard-hitting nature of the music.

The Surge of Hardstyle: Global Recognition and Growth
By the mid-2000s, hardstyle started to get more recognition within the broader EDM community. This was largely as a result of the success of several vital artists who assisted popularize the category and bring it to a larger audience. Artists like Headhunterz, Wildstylez, and Brennan Heart contributed in shaping the modern hardstyle audio, integrating more ariose and blissful elements while keeping the compelling kicks and rapid paces.

Headhunterz, in particular, is credited with assisting to bring hardstyle to the mainstream. His tracks, such as "The Power of the Mind" and "Dragonborn," became anthems in the hardstyle neighborhood and helped to boost the genre's profile on the global stage. Headhunterz' special blend of euphoric melodies and powerful kicks resonated with fans and aided to attract brand-new audiences to hardstyle, most of whom were formerly not familiar with the category.

In 2008, Headhunterz' performance at Defqon.1, one of the world's largest hardstyle festivals, further strengthened his condition as a leading figure in the genre. Defqon.1, arranged by Q-dance, is a celebration that has played an essential role in promoting hardstyle and showcasing the genre's leading skill. Held annually in the Netherlands, Defqon.1 has actually come to be synonymous with hardstyle and has actually broadened to international versions in Australia and Chile, helping to spread out hardstyle's influence to various other parts of the globe.

As hardstyle acquired extra worldwide direct exposure, its fanbase grew rapidly. The style's combination of high-energy beats, melodic malfunctions, and euphoric climaxes struck home with EDM fans who hungered for something harder and faster than typical home or hypnotic trance music. Celebrations like Qlimax, Decibel Outdoor, and Difficult Bass came to be hubs for hardstyle lovers, bring in thousands of fans from all over the world.

The Elements of Hardstyle: Defining the Category
A number of components define hardstyle and set it aside from other electronic songs categories:

Kicks: The tough, battering kick drum is one of the most specifying feature of hardstyle. In very early hardstyle, these kicks were commonly distorted and pitched, giving them a special appearance and really feel. As the category has developed, kicks have become cleaner, more refined, and often split with sub-bass regularities to include deepness.

Reverse Bass: One website more key element of hardstyle is the reverse bass, a distinct audio produced by reversing the tail of the kick drum to create a rolling, jumping impact. This technique adds to the driving power of the music and is a characteristic of traditional hardstyle tracks.

Melodies: While hardstyle is known for its compelling beats, it also includes melodious components, especially in its blissful and raw subgenres. These melodies are often psychological and uplifting, creating a comparison with the aggressive kicks and adding a feeling of progression to the track.

Accumulations and Climaxes: Hardstyle tracks normally follow a framework that consists of a build-up, decrease, and orgasm. The build-up develops stress, frequently making use of rising synths and vocal examples, while the decline delivers the full force of the kick drum and bassline. The orgasm is where the tune and rhythm come together, producing an extreme, blissful release of power.

Paces: Hardstyle is typically produced at tempos ranging from 140 to 150 beats per minute (BPM), making it quicker than categories like residence or techno, yet slower than hardcore or gabber. The fast pace, incorporated with the effective kicks, offers hardstyle its unrelenting, driving power.

Hardstyle Subgenres: Blissful, Raw, and Beyond
As hardstyle has actually advanced, numerous subgenres have actually emerged, each with its own distinct sound and fanbase. These subgenres mirror the variety within the hardstyle area and the style's capability to adapt and grow:

Euphoric Hardstyle: Blissful hardstyle emphasizes uplifting tunes and psychological break downs, creating a more obtainable and feel-good ambiance. Artists like Headhunterz, Wildstylez, and Noisecontrollers are recognized for their euphoric tracks, which frequently include appealing vocal hooks and rising synths.

Rawstyle: Rawstyle is the darker, more hostile side of hardstyle, identified by altered kicks, heavy bass, and marginal melodies. Artists like Radical Redemption, E-Force, and Warface are recognized for their rawstyle tracks, which typically have a harder, a lot more commercial edge. Rawstyle has actually gained a committed following among fans that prefer the harder, a lot more extreme side of hardstyle.

Freestyle: Freestyle blends aspects of hardstyle with other styles like hardcore, catch, and dubstep. This subgenre is known for its experimental nature and genre-bending technique, with musicians like Partyraiser and Dr. copyright leading the way.

The Global Hardstyle Neighborhood: Events and Events
One of the most amazing elements of hardstyle is the feeling of neighborhood amongst its followers. Hardstyle events and occasions are greater than simply positions to listen to songs-- they are celebrations where followers come together to celebrate their shared love of the genre. Several of one of the most significant hardstyle celebrations include:

Defqon.1: Held yearly in the Netherlands, Defqon.1 is the largest hardstyle celebration in the world, attracting over 60,000 followers. Recognized for its enormous stages, pyrotechnics, and high-energy performances, Defqon.1 is the peak of the hardstyle event experience.

Qlimax: One more renowned hardstyle event, Qlimax is recognized for its staged stage layouts and immersive manufacturing. Held yearly in the Netherlands, Qlimax is one of one of the most distinguished hardstyle events, attracting fans from all over the world.

Decibel Outdoor: Decibel is among the longest-running hardstyle festivals, including multiple phases and a varied lineup of musicians from across the tough dance spectrum. The event occurs in the Netherlands and is known for its high-energy environment and dedicated fanbase.

Hardstyle's Influence on EDM and Popular Culture
Hardstyle's impact has prolonged past the confines of the EDM globe and right into mainstream pop culture. Over the years, components of hardstyle have been integrated right into various other genres, with musicians from outside the hardstyle area experimenting with its sounds. For instance, mainstream EDM musicians like W&W and Steve Aoki have actually included hardstyle components right into their tracks, bringing the style to a more comprehensive target market.

Hardstyle's impact can also be seen in the fitness world, with hardstyle songs often being used in high-intensity workouts due to its fast pace and energised beats. The style's organization with celebrations and rave culture has actually likewise made it a staple of fashion and lifestyle brands targeting young, energised target markets.
